Whether you refer to it as Middle Hitter or Middle Blocker, anyone who plays this position knows it’s lonely at the top.
That’s because, in the front row the Middle position is where most defensive efforts start. These are the players with the highest level of responsibility for adjusting and rejecting opposing spikes. Entire game plans have been formulated and executed based on exactly what the Middle Hitter can and can’t do.
This rule holds especially true when it comes to 17U competition here in Michigan. As for who exactly is minding the store at this spot is a pool of talent that’s as deep as it is rich and includes…
NICOLE MILES
In her game film on Maxpreps.com Miles exhibits a true feel for the flow of the other team and uses that to hit the ball where they aren’t. At the same time she can wield her right arm like a hammer when that’s what it takes to get things done. In club play this five-foot-eleven junior suits up for Legends 17 ADIDAS and during the high school season she competes for Brighton. This year in prep play she was in action for 45 sets and posted 29 kills, 26 triple blocks and three blocks.
KAYLEY ULBRIK
Playing both ways is something this player does well, as evidenced by the fact she sported 100 kills, 58 triple blocks and 37 blocks this past prep season. That was for L’Anse Creuse North High School in Macomb. Presently she’s a member of Crank It Volleyball’s 17U Becca squad and the class of 2021. As a team the Crusaders went 46-8 overall, 10-0 league, to end up ranked 18th in the state and 674th nationally.
HANNAH KEENAN
While now a Middle Hitter for Far Out Volleyball 17 Black, Keenan played for Marshall High School in prep action, which came in ranked 88th in Michigan and 3,043rd nationally. This junior has drawn the attention of Wayne State, and with good cause. Defensively she gets high enough to block shots with her wrists using a two-handed approach. She’s also strong on the serve and gets low incredibly well, a task that becomes that much more impressive when you consider her height.
SASHA AKUEZE
The ability to slide to both sides and form a defensive wall at the net in tandem with a teammate makes this player especially important to the overall formula for Legends 17 ADIDAS. On the flip side this five-foot-10 junior at Ann Arbor Skyline High School has a strong right arm and puts a downward trajectory on the ball that forces the opposition to get low quicker than they’re generally able. In 2019-20 she played 142 sets for the Eagles and accumulated 150 kills, 56 triple blocks and 11 blocks.
EVELYN FOOKS
This Middle Hitter for Crank It Volleyball 17U Becca experienced the good and the bad during the high school season. That meant this junior at Grosse Pointe North High School was part of a team that went 3-22-1 overall, 1-4 league, during the prep season. Standing five foot-10 Fooks was able to get four sets worth of action for that squad and took part in nine triple-blocks with three kills and one dig.
MAIA BUDRICK
Despite not getting as much time as she would’ve liked with Caledonia High School in 2019-20, Burdick still found a way to sneak in 28 kills, 18 digs, seven triple-blocks and one assist. This Middle Blocker is a member of the class of 2021, presently plays for Far Out Volleyball 17 Red and helped the Fighting Scots go 21-23-1 overall, 5-7 league, to earn rankings of 70th in the state and 2,283rd nationally, as well.
